Rector Tetyana Kaganovska Honored with the National Award "Woman of Ukraine"

30 may 2025 year

On May 29, 2025, the Karazin University community congratulated Rector Tetyana Kaganovska on winning the "Higher Education" category of the National Award "Woman of Ukraine" for 2025 — an award that honors those whose work is changing our country and the world.

Ms. Tetyana is the first woman rector in the history of Karazin University. Since the beginning of the full-scale war, she has been leading one of the oldest and most prestigious higher education institutions in Ukraine, focusing her efforts on ensuring the continuity of the educational process, preserving the university's scientific potential, restoring infrastructure damaged by hostilities, expanding international cooperation, and securing partner support.

The "Woman of Ukraine" award is not only a mark of high recognition, but also a testament to the trust in leadership, resilience, and strategic vision aimed at safeguarding and advancing Ukrainian education.
